How much does it cost to rent a home in McGregor?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
McGregor 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,141 | $1,200 | $5,600 |
McGregor 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,659 | $1,550 | $5,750 |
McGregor 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,837 | $4,500 | $8,950 |
McGregor 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,250 | $6,250 | $6,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about McGregor
What type of rentals are currently available in McGregor?
There are currently 26 Apartments for Rent in McGregor,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,090 to $3,095. There are also 109 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in McGregor ranging from $1,200 to $8,950.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in McGregor?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in McGregor ranges from $1,200 to $8,950 with an average monthly rent of $3,867.
